“And Samuel said, hath the LORD as great delight in burnt offerings and sacrifices, as in obeying the voice of the LORD? Behold, to obey is better than sacrifice, and to hearken than the fat of rams” (Ephesians 3:20).
The Lord Jesus, in John 4:23, outlines true worship as that which is done in spirit and in truth. There’s no other way. Serving the Lord has to be from your spirit and according to His Word. His Word provides the guidance, the prescribed order of service and worship in the Kingdom.
You don’t give God what you choose or just what you like; you give Him what He has asked for, in the way that He asked for it. You serve Him according to His demands, not according to your feelings or emotions. There’re people who say, “Everyone can serve God in His own way!” That’s not true. When you study the Bible, you’d find that those who tried to serve God in their own way got killed or rebuked by God.
Genesis 4 tells us of the story of Cain and Abel: two brothers who brought their offerings to the Lord. Cain brought an offering of his choice, while Abel brought what God asked to be offered. Abel’s offering was accepted, but Cain’s sacrifice was rejected. In Genesis 4:7, seeing that Cain was angry, the Lord rebuked him saying, “If thou doest well, shalt thou not be accepted?”
How about Moses, who, instead of talking to the rock, struck the rock? Water came out, and the people drank to their fill, but God was displeased and rebuked Moses (Numbers 20:1-12, Deuteronomy 4:21-22). Uzzah was killed when he tried to render service to God by stabilizing the stumbling Ark of God at Nachon’s threshing floor (2 Samuel 6:6-7).
If you want to serve God rightly, give more attention to studying the Scriptures. He will grant you the wisdom and insight of the Spirit on how to serve Him truly, with a pure heart and a willing mind.

“For the cloud of the LORD was upon the tabernacle by day, and fire was on it by night, in the sight of all the house of Israel, throughout all their journeys” (Exodus 40:38).
Matthew 17 tells us that Peter, James and John were with Jesus on the Mount of Transfiguration. While they were there, Moses and Elijah appeared, and suddenly, the cloud of God covered them (Matthew 17:5). This same cloud was referenced in Exodus 13:21 and Exodus 16:10 (study both references).
We find a remarkable scenario in our theme verse: for forty years, the children of Israel saw the cloud of God’s glory upon the tabernacle by day, and as a pillar of fire by night. This is really significant, because Isaiah 63:9 says, “In all their affliction he was afflicted, and the angel of his presence saved them: in his love and in his pity he redeemed them; and he bare them, and carried them all the days of old.”
The next verse tells us that the Angel of His presence is the Holy Spirit: “But they rebelled, and vexed his holy Spirit: therefore he was turned to be their enemy, and he fought against them” (Isaiah 63:10). He was the One that was with them in that cloud of glory. Then the Bible says in 1 Corinthians 10:1-2: “Moreover, brethren, I would not that ye should be ignorant, how that all our fathers were under the cloud, and all passed through the sea; And were all baptized unto Moses in the cloud and in the sea.” Remarkable!
Now, 2 Chronicles 5:1-14 gives us an interesting account: Solomon had built the temple of God, and the priests were to take the Ark of God from the old tabernacle and bring it into the new temple built by Solomon. When the Ark was brought in, this same cloud of glory filled the temple, so much so that the priests couldn’t stand to minister in the Holy Place. Hallelujah!
That glory is in you and overshadows you today, because you’re the bearer of the Ark. The ark of God is in your heart today because His Word is written in your heart (Jeremiah 31:33, Hebrews 8:10). The Word is where the glory is. As long as you give the Word of God its place in your life, you’ll always be covered in that cloud of glory, where you’re shielded from evil and all the depravities in the world. Praise God!

And he is the head of the body, the church: who is the beginning, the firstborn from the dead; that in all things he might have the preeminence (Colossians 1:18).
The expression, “the firstborn from the dead,” doesn’t mean the first to rise from the dead. Prior to Jesus’ vicarious death, there were those who had been raised from the dead, but what the Apostle Paul communicates by the Spirit here, is different. When Jesus died, He died in the spirit, therefore, He was the first to come out of spiritual death.
Spiritual death is separation from God. As Jesus hung on the cross, He suffered the agony of being separated from the Father. The Bible says He cried out with a loud voice, “…Eloi, Eloi, lama sabachthani? which is, being interpreted, My God, my God, why hast thou forsaken me?” (Mark 15:34). This was a result of His being made sin for us. His separation from the Father was for our sake. The Bible says, “For he hath made him to be sin for us, who knew no sin; that we might be made the righteousness of God in him” (2 Corinthians 5:21).
It should have been illegal for Jesus to be in hell, because He was without sin, but He went to Hell in our place. Colossians 2:15 captures how He engaged Satan in that awful combat in hell, and defeated him and all the cohorts of darkness: “And having spoiled principalities and powers, he made a shew of them openly, triumphing over them in it.”
No one ever came out of spiritual death or out of Satan’s bondage, but Jesus did. He paid the full penalty for every man. Accordingly, because a righteous man was given for sinners, it became legal, and possible, for sinners to be given His righteousness. He took our place of sin, that we might obtain His righteousness. Now, we’re as righteous as Jesus is!
He has made you the very expression of His righteousness because He died spiritually for you, and when He came out of death, you were in Him. Now you reign and rule with Him in the heavenly realms—in the realm of life. Blessed be God!

Above all, taking the shield of faith, wherewith ye shall be able to quench all the fiery darts of the wicked…and the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God (Ephesians 6:16-17).
The Word of God is a sword; it’s an offensive weapon for spiritual warfare. Notice that Paul didn’t say, “And take … the sword of the Spirit, which is the written word (logos) of God.” He didn’t ask that you thrust, swerve, or strike the enemy with a physical copy of the Bible as you would a physical sword, no! The Greek rendering for "word" is "Rhema," and it means the spoken Word.
‘Rhema’ is a specific Word at a specific time, for a specific purpose. Thus, the ‘Rhema’ of God is the Word of God from your heart to your mouth—the inspired Word that comes out of your mouth. In the Master’s encounter with the devil, the Bible tells us, “Jesus answered him, saying, It is written, man shall not live by bread alone, but by every word of God” (Luke 4:4). Again, the underlined word is translated “Rhema” (Greek). The Lord Jesus, in speaking “Rhema,” wielded the sword of the Spirit (the weapon of the spoken word) and discomfited the devil.
God’s “Rhema” word isn’t just a word that’s kept in your heart; rather, it’s inspired by God and comes out of your mouth. It’s always a word said, or a word in saying. Hallelujah! Always put the word on your lips; if it’s not coming out of your mouth, it’s not a sword, it’s not a weapon.
Just as the “Rhema” word is a weapon with which you get on the offensive against the adversary, your faith is a weapon, a shield against the adversary and his onslaught: “Above all, taking the shield of faith, wherewith ye shall be able to quench all the fiery darts of the wicked.” You don’t have to look around for a shield called faith; faith is in your spirit. You were born again with the measure of faith you require (Romans 12:3) to live victoriously and reign gloriously in life. All you need do is grow it by more of God’s Word, and strengthen it by using it.
That faith neutralizes, quenches, defuses, and puts out all the fiery darts the enemy throws at you. Your faith is the victory over all circumstances and adversities of life: “For whatsoever is born of God overcometh the world: and this is the victory that overcometh the world, even our faith” (1 John 5:4).
